64 MHz core vs. 32 MHz siblings — where the speed matters

At 64 MHz, this part runs twice the clock of the PIC16LF1559 (32 MHz) and the 16-bit PIC24FJ256GA106 (32 MHz). That extra headroom tightens timing for software UART bit-banging, PID control loops, or protocol parsing. The 36 I/O pins — versus 17 on the PIC16LF1559 — give room for parallel sensor banks or a parallel LCD databus without a port expander.

40-QFN exposed pad — layout and thermal handling

The pad is electrically connected to VSS — confirm that in your layout so it doesn't short to an isolated island. The internal oscillator starts up without an external crystal, but if you need tighter timing, the part supports an external clock source.

What development tools support PIC18F46Q43-I/MP?

Microchip's MPLAB X IDE and the MPLAB Code Configurator (MCC) tool generate initialization code for the PIC18F46Q43. The PICkit 4, ICD 4, and MPLAB Snap debuggers connect via the ICSP interface. The internal oscillator runs at 64 MHz without an external crystal, simplifying the first-power checklist.

What is the listed speed of PIC18F46Q43-I/MP?

64 MHz. That is the maximum core clock — the internal oscillator can generate this frequency directly, so no external clock source is required for full-speed operation.
